What Are The Most Effective Ventilation Strategies For Maintaining Optimal Humidity Levels Indoors?

Introduction

Maintaining optimal indoor humidity levels is crucial for enhancing comfort, safeguarding health, and preserving your home’s structural integrity. Implementing effective ventilation strategies is vital for regulating indoor humidity by improving airflow and reducing moisture accumulation.

Understanding Indoor Humidity Levels

Indoor humidity levels refer to the concentration of water vapor in the air and play a significant role in health and safety. High humidity can cause numerous issues, such as mold growth and allergen proliferation, while low humidity can lead to discomfort and respiratory problems. The recommended indoor humidity range is between 30% and 50%. Excess moisture can heighten discomfort and health risks, while excessively low humidity can result in skin dryness and even exacerbate asthma.

  • Humidity can be accurately measured using a hygrometer.
  • Indicators of high indoor humidity include condensation on windows, musty odors, and visible mold.
  • Low humidity symptoms include dry skin, chapped lips, cracked wood, and increased static electricity.

Implementing Effective Ventilation Techniques

Utilizing effective ventilation techniques is crucial for managing indoor humidity levels. Here are several approaches to enhance your indoor climate:

  • Install exhaust fans in moisture-prone areas such as kitchens and bathrooms to expel humid air efficiently.
  • Open windows on dry, breezy days to promote fresh air circulation and minimize humid air buildup.
  • Consider integrating whole-house ventilation systems to ensure consistent airflow throughout your entire home.
  • Use a dehumidifier in damp areas, such as basements, to extract excess moisture from the air.
  • Ensure proper insulation and vapor barriers are in place to prevent moisture infiltration into living spaces.
  • Regular maintenance of HVAC systems is essential; clean and change filters regularly to optimize indoor air quality.

Monitoring and Adjusting Indoor Humidity

Regularly monitoring and adjusting indoor humidity levels are essential for health and comfort. Here’s how to effectively manage humidity in your home:

  • Regularly check humidity levels using a hygrometer and make necessary adjustments based on the readings.
  • Be cautious of humidity levels dropping in winter due to heating; use a humidifier to reintroduce moisture into the air.
  • During summer, keep windows closed on humid days and use air conditioning to help dehumidify indoor air.
